Rohra Population - Raipur, Chhattisgarh
Rohra is a large village located in Simga Tehsil of Raipur district, Chhattisgarh with total 611 families residing. The Rohra village has population of 2947 of which 1494 are males while 1453 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Rohra village population of children with age 0-6 is 447 which makes up 15.17 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Rohra village is 973 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Rohra as per census is 927,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Rohra village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Rohra village was 66.96 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Rohra Male literacy stands at 78.29 % while female literacy rate was 55.41 %.

Rohra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 611 | - | - |
Population | 2,947 | 1,494 | 1,453 |
Child (0-6) | 447 | 232 | 215 |
Schedule Caste | 693 | 356 | 337 |
Schedule Tribe | 85 | 45 | 40 |
Literacy | 66.96 % | 78.29 % | 55.41 % |
Total Workers | 1,380 | 783 | 597 |
Main Worker | 427 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 953 | 402 | 551 |
